Police and emergency services personnel and volunteers drew the attention of shoppers in Boonah on Thursday to the Rural Road Safety Month message that all road users play a role in reducing risks on rural roads. Displays in Park Street highlighted the Fatal 5 - speeding, seatbelts, mobile phones and distractions, drink or drug driving, and fatigue. The event included a demonstration of how an injured driver is freed from a crashed car. This week, Constable Andrew Conway reported that Fassifern Police have issued 97 traffic infringement notices in the division since the beginning of the month.
